DYNAMIC RECONSTRUCTION OF APPLICATION STATE UPON APPLICATION RE-LAUNCH
    2.
    发明申请
    DYNAMIC RECONSTRUCTION OF APPLICATION STATE UPON APPLICATION RE-LAUNCH 审中-公开
    应用程序重新启动后的动态重建

    公开(公告)号:US20170060558A1

    公开(公告)日:2017-03-02

    申请号:US15351330

    申请日:2016-11-14

    Abstract: A service provider system may include an application fulfillment platform that delivers desktop applications on demand to desktops on physical computing devices or virtual desktop instances of end users. An application delivery agent installed on an end user's computing resource instance may store application state data (e.g., configuration data, runtime settings, or application templates) or scratch data that is generated by an application executing on the computing resource instance to a secure location on service provider storage resources. After a machine failure or change, or a rebuilding of a virtualized computing resource instance or virtual desktop instance, an application delivery agent installed on the new machine or instance may reinstall the application, retrieve the stored application state or scratch data from service provider resources, and restore the application to the last known persisted state. Upon request, the application delivery agent may restore the application to any earlier persisted state.

    Abstract translation: 服务提供商系统可以包括应用程序履行平台,其将桌面应用按需传送到最终用户的物理计算设备或虚拟桌面实例上的桌面。 安装在最终用户的计算资源实例上的应用传送代理可以将应用状态数据(例如,配置数据,运行时设置或应用模板)或由在计算资源实例上执行的应用生成的临时数据存储到安全位置上 服务提供商存储资源。 在机器故障或更改或重建虚拟化计算资源实例或虚拟桌面实例之后,安装在新机器或实例上的应用程序交付代理可能会重新安装应用程序,从服务提供商资源中检索存储的应用程序状态或暂存数据, 并将应用程序还原到最后已知的持久状态。 根据请求,应用交付代理可以将应用恢复到任何早期的持久状态。

    DESKTOP APPLICATION FULFILLMENT PLATFORM WITH MULTIPLE AUTHENTICATION MECHANISMS
    3.
    发明申请
    DESKTOP APPLICATION FULFILLMENT PLATFORM WITH MULTIPLE AUTHENTICATION MECHANISMS 有权
    具有多种认证机制的桌面应用程序平台

    公开(公告)号:US20160134616A1

    公开(公告)日:2016-05-12

    申请号:US14537789

    申请日:2014-11-10

    Abstract: A service provider system may include an application fulfillment platform that delivers desktop applications to desktops on physical computing devices or virtual desktop instances. A computing resource instance may be registered with the platform, which generates a unique identifier and a security token for the computing resource instance using multiple authentication mechanisms. An end user of a customer organization may be registered with the platform, which generates a unique identifier and a security token for the end user using multiple authentication mechanisms. An application delivery agent may submit service requests to the platform on behalf of itself or the given user. The identity and security credentials included in the requests may be dependent on the request type and the entities on whose behalf they are submitted. A proxy service on the platform may receive the requests and validate the credentials, then dispatch the requests to other services on the platform.

    Abstract translation: 服务提供商系统可以包括将桌面应用传送到物理计算设备或虚拟桌面实例上的桌面的应用程序执行平台。 可以向平台注册计算资源实例,该平台使用多个认证机制来生成计算资源实例的唯一标识符和安全令牌。 客户组织的最终用户可以向平台注册,该平台使用多个认证机制为最终用户生成唯一的标识符和安全令牌。 应用交付代理可以代表自身或给定用户向平台提交服务请求。 请求中包含的身份和安全凭据可能取决于请求类型和代表其提交的实体。 平台上的代理服务可以接收请求并验证凭据,然后将请求发送到平台上的其他服务。

    ON-DEMAND DELIVERY OF APPLICATIONS TO VIRTUAL DESKTOPS
    4.
    发明申请
    ON-DEMAND DELIVERY OF APPLICATIONS TO VIRTUAL DESKTOPS 审中-公开
    应用于虚拟桌面的需求交付

    公开(公告)号:US20160112497A1

    公开(公告)日:2016-04-21

    申请号:US14516233

    申请日:2014-10-16

    Abstract: A service provider system may include an application fulfillment platform that delivers desktop applications on demand to desktops on physical computing devices or virtual desktop instances. The applications may be selected for delivery from a catalog of applications, and may be required to be installed on the destination computing resource instance, or may be assigned to a customer's end user on whose behalf the resource instance was provisioned. A workflow for deploying a selected application may invoke services implemented on the platform. The desktop application may be delivered as a virtualized application package that is subsequently executed by a runtime engine installed on the end user's resource instance, without installing the selected application itself on the computing resource instance. A customer's IT administrators may create and populate the catalog, add customer-generated or customer-licensed applications, assign applications to users, apply constraints on application use, and monitor application usage.

    Abstract translation: 服务提供商系统可以包括将物理计算设备或虚拟桌面实例上的桌面应用按需传递到应用程序执行平台。 可以选择应用程序以从应用程序目录中传递,并且可能需要将其安装在目标计算资源实例上,或者可以将其分配给代表资源实例的用户的最终用户。 部署所选应用程序的工作流可以调用在平台上实现的服务。 桌面应用程序可以作为虚拟化应用程序包传送,随后由安装在最终用户资源实例上的运行时引擎执行,而不将所选应用程序本身安装在计算资源实例上。 客户的IT管理员可以创建和填充目录,添加客户生成或客户许可的应用程序,将应用程序分配给用户,应用程序使用限制和监视应用程序使用情况。

Patent Agency Ranking